WebAnswer (1 of 3): Each school district makes its own dress code, which includes haircuts. Most public schools don’t care what your hair is like, as long as it’s not too distracting to other students. (Like, you can’t put flashing lights in your hair.) WebIf your school provides transport (e.g. by running a school bus) to and from school, you would be under the school’s care and be expected to wear your uniform.
